The sixty-fourth session of the Commission on the Status of Women

The sixty-fourth session of the Commission on the Status of Women will take place at the United Nations Headquarters in New York from 9 to 20 March 2020. The Generation Equality Forum

The Generation Equality Forum is a civil society-led, multi-stakeholder gathering taking place within the context of the 25th anniversary of the Beijing Declaration and Platform for Action, with two major meetings to be held in Mexico, 7-8 May 2020 and Paris, 7-10 July 2020.
